基于超声多普勒人工心脏血栓检测系统的研究

摘    要:血栓是制约人工心脏发展的一大难题,有效的检测出血栓对人工心脏的研究具有重要的意义。文章详细研究了超声多普勒血栓检测系统的原理,实现方法,包括超声波探头、发射/接收电路、处理及采集系统的设计并利用短时傅里叶对血栓信号进行分析,并根据实验对血栓检测系统的分辨率进行了验证。

关 键 词:人工心脏  血栓  超声多普勒  短时傅里叶分析

Thrombus detection system in artificial heart based on ultrasonic Doppler

Abstract:The thrombus formation is a serious complication in the development of artificial heart,so it is of great importance to detect the thrombus efficiently within the artificial heart.It is feasible to adopt the method of Ultrasonic Doppler for thrombus detection.This paper elaborates the principle,approaches of the thrombus detection system using Ultrasonic Doppler,including designing of the ultrasonic probe,Transmitter/Receive circuit,data processing and col-lecting system,and then through careful analysis of the thrombus signals by short-time Fourier analysis(STFT),the mimicking thrombus is detected.
Keywords:artificial heart  thrombus  ultrasonic doppler  STFT
